Software Development

Elevate Your IT Capabilities: Access a Dedicated Team of Experts Without the Overhead Costs!

Benefits of managed IT services provided by Cod Xpert

Partner with Cod Xpert for Software Development services that empower your business with innovative, scalable, and secure solutions. Let us transform your ideas into robust software applications that drive efficiency, productivity, and business growth.

Customized Solutions

We develop tailor-made software solutions designed to address your specific business requirements. Our experts work closely with you to understand your needs and create bespoke software that aligns with your processes, enhances efficiency, and improves overall productivity.

Increased Efficiency

Our software solutions automate manual processes, streamline workflows, and eliminate redundant tasks, resulting in improved operational efficiency. By leveraging technology to optimize your business processes, you can save time, reduce errors, and allocate resources more effectively.

Integration Capabilities

Our software solutions seamlessly integrate with existing systems, databases, and third-party applications, enabling efficient data sharing and collaboration. This integration streamlines processes, reduces data silos, and provides a unified view of your operations, facilitating better decision-making.

Ongoing Support and Maintenance

We offer comprehensive support and maintenance services to ensure your software operates optimally. Our team provides regular updates, bug fixes, and technical assistance to address any issues and keep your software running smoothly.

The Future of Your Business Starts with Custom Software Development

The future of your business lies in embracing the power of custom software development. In today’s fast-paced and highly competitive digital landscape, off-the-shelf solutions are no longer sufficient to meet the unique needs and challenges of your business. By harnessing the potential of custom software development, you gain a strategic advantage, enhance efficiency, improve customer experiences, and propel your business towards sustainable growth. 

Invest in the future of your business today by partnering with our expert team for custom software development that aligns perfectly with your vision and goals.

Elevate Your Business with Cutting-Edge Software Development

Throughout the entire software development process, we maintain regular communication with clients, providing updates and seeking feedback to ensure their satisfaction.

Requirement Gathering

Our team collaborates closely with clients to understand their software requirements, business objectives, and target audience. We conduct thorough analysis and gather detailed specifications to ensure a clear understanding of the project scope.

Planning and Design

In this phase, we create a comprehensive plan outlining the software architecture, system design, and technical requirements. We develop wireframes, user interface designs, and prototypes to provide clients with a visual representation of the final product.


Our experienced developers utilize industry-standard programming languages and frameworks to bring the software to life. They follow agile methodologies, breaking the development process into manageable tasks and regularly communicating progress to ensure alignment with client expectations.

Testing and Quality Assurance

We conduct rigorous testing to ensure the software functions as intended and meets the specified requirements. Our quality assurance team performs various types of testing, including functional testing, performance testing, security testing, and user acceptance testing, to identify and resolve any issues.

Deployment and Integration

Once the software passes all quality checks, we proceed with deployment and integration. We carefully migrate the software to the production environment, configure servers, databases, and other components, and integrate the software with any necessary third-party systems or APIs.

User Training and Documentation

We provide comprehensive user training to ensure a smooth adoption of the software. Additionally, we create detailed documentation, including user manuals, technical specifications, and support guides, to assist users in utilizing the software effectively.

Maintenance and Support

We offer ongoing maintenance and support services to address any software issues, apply updates, and provide technical assistance as needed. Our team remains accessible to handle any queries, bug fixes, or enhancements to ensure the software continues to operate optimally.

Contact us

Partner with Us for Comprehensive IT

We’re happy to answer any questions you may have and help you determine which of our services best fit your needs.

Your benefits:
What happens next?

We Schedule a call at your convenience 


We do a discovery and consulting meeting 


We prepare a proposal 

Schedule a Free Consultation